2016-12-08 14 views
0

2番目または3番目のパッチセットの差分を起点として確認する方法はありますか?以前のパッチセットまたはベースではありません2番目のパッチセットをゲリットの起点と比較する方法

シナリオはです。最初は最初のパッチセットをレビューしてレビューコメントを出し、レビューコメントを組み込んだ第2のパッチセットをレビューしました。元に合併する前に、2番目のパッチセットを原点でチェックしたいと思う。

このようなものReview board - Compare 5th review set with origin ゲリットとは全く同じですか?

アップデート:パッチと

比較ベースでは1つの番組がベースに存在しなかったが、追加され、レビューコメントがどこを与えられた1つの Diff with base and patch 1 log.warnメッセージ起源とパッチでdiffを設定します。パッチを有するベースを比較

は原点とパッチ1とパッチ2の間の差分はありませんを示し、ログメッセージとして2つの enter image description here今ベースショーパッチセット2既に原点に存在しないされています。

コミットが修正されました。それが問題ならば。

+0

「起源」と「ベース」の違いを明確にしてください。 –

+0

私の理解は根元が原点です。 –

答えて

0

はい。変更されたファイルのいずれかをクリックすると、diff、side-by-side diffまたはunified diffのいずれかが表示されます。上部には、「Patch Set Base 1 2 3」が両側に表示されています。デフォルトで左側の部分はベースにあり、右側の部分はデフォルトで現在のパッチセットにあります。両側の別のパッチセットに切り替えることができます。統一差分はほぼ同じです。

+0

私の場合はベース1、ベース2が最初のパッチセット、1が最初のパッチ(私のレビューコメント)、2は新しいレビューです。左に私は起源を選択することができません –

+0

gitコミットが修正されたことを忘れていたbtw。大事な場合は –

+0

@DheerajJoshiベースは起源です – ElpieKay

0

あなたはすでにdiffプロセスを正しく実行していますが、実際にはlog.warn行はbase-patchset2 diffには表示されません。

私はこの問題について、いくつかの可能性で考えることができます。

  1. あなたはド変更をリベースことがありますか?

  2. 私たちをだましているコードと変更には、特別な状況があります。画像に他のソースコード行がないため、分析することはできません。欠けている線を表示することは可能ですか?

  3. バグがあります。どのGerritバージョンを使用していますか?

関連する問題